What Types of Work and Facilities Can Dialysis Registered Nurses Expect in Scranton, PA?

As a Dialysis Registered Nurse in Scranton, Pennsylvania, you can expect to find diverse opportunities across various healthcare facilities, including hospitals, outpatient dialysis centers, and community health clinics that cater to patients with kidney-related conditions. In these settings, your role will involve assessing patients’ health status, managing dialysis treatments, monitoring vital signs, and collaborating with interdisciplinary teams to ensure optimal patient care. Facilities such as regional hospitals may provide acute dialysis services, while specialized outpatient centers offer chronic dialysis to patients in need of ongoing treatment. Additionally, you may have the opportunity to engage in patient education and support, fostering a compassionate environment for individuals navigating their health challenges. Join AMN Healthcare as a Travel RN-Dialysis in Tuscaloosa, Alabama. Dialysis ratios – 1:2 (RN:patient) or 1:3 (RN + CCHT:patient). Equipment- DCH currently uses Fresenius machines, Gambro as needed. Our Regional unit has eight dialysis bays, and the ability to perform bedside and peritoneal dialysis. The Northport campus has four dialysis bays and the ability to perform bedside and peritoneal dialysis. To qualify, you must have a current RN license and at least 2 years of recent dialysis experience. Proficiency with Meditech electronic medical records (EMR) and experience with dialysis procedures are required. Strong communication and critical thinking skills are essential.
